8 интерфейс поставщика услуг
интерфейс поставщика услуг
(ITIL Service Strategy)
Интерфейс между поставщиком ИТ-услуг и пользователем, заказчиком, бизнес-процессом или подрядчиком. Анализ интерфейсов поставщика услуг помогает координировать сквозное управление ИТ- услугами.
[Словарь терминов ITIL версия 1.0, 29 июля 2011 г.]EN
service provider interface
SPI
(ITIL Service Strategy)
An interface between the IT service provider and a user, customer, business process or supplier. Analysis of service provider interfaces helps to coordinate end-to-end management of IT services.
